Shelia Rietesel

July 28, 1946 - March 17, 2022

Shelia S. Rietesel Shelia S. Rietesel 75, passed away March 17th 2022 peacefully surrounded by Family in Community Hospice of Jacksonville after a lengthy illness. She was born in Louisville KY on July 28th of 1946, the Only daughter of Jim and Geraldine Stephenson. Shelia graduated from Cocoa High in 1965 and 2 years later met and Married Lawrence Armour and they went on to have 2 children. She became a widow in 1974. In addition to her Parents she is predeceased by her brother Steve (Stephenson), her Step-Daughter Shelly (Armour) and her Great Grandson Ethan (Hoeffer). She was survived by so many people that loved her: 1 Brother Jim Stephenson (Maxine) Her 2 children Deborah Hoeffer Hayes (Will) and Lawrence "Gunner" Armour. 8 Grandchildren.. Ashley White, Chris Zuravnsky (Lauren), Brandon Hoeffer (Jessy), Tristan Hoeffer (Etienne), Amber Carver (Derek), Todd Hunter, Autumn Armour, Angela Armour (Scott) Also she had 8 wonderful grandchildren Caiden, Austin, Kyleigh, Gracie, Brodee, Eli, Carolynne and Beckett.
